While Unmesh Dinda has not coded a dedicated panel, his methodology has effectively replaced the need for expensive commercial plugins. By mastering his manual techniques—edge cleaning via Channels, lighting matching via Curves, and depth creation via Dodge & Burn—you become the plugin.
